For Thai traders, trading costs significantly impact profitability, especially when dealing in THB conversions. OctaFX offers variable spreads from 0.0 pips on EUR/USD with a $7 commission per lot, making it ideal for high-volume scalpers. EasyMarkets charges fixed spreads averaging 1.2 pips on the same pair with no commission, which is higher but predictable. Over 100 trades per month, OctaFX can save a Thai trader several hundred dollars in spread costs. However, EasyMarkets’ fixed spreads protect against widening during volatile Asian sessions, a benefit for traders who hold positions overnight.

OctaFX uses No Dealing Desk (NDD) execution with ECN connectivity, offering average execution speeds of 0.1 seconds and minimal slippage—ideal for Thai scalpers. EasyMarkets operates as a market maker with dealing desk intervention, which can cause requotes during fast markets. For Thai traders executing high-frequency strategies, OctaFX provides superior execution quality. EasyMarkets’ guaranteed stop loss, however, protects against slippage on exit orders.

EasyMarkets is regulated by the FCA (UK), CySEC (Cyprus), and ASIC (Australia), offering Thai traders client fund segregation and negative balance protection under these regimes. OctaFX holds an FSA (SVG) license, which is less strict and provides no compensation scheme. Neither broker is authorized by the SEC Thailand, so Thai traders have no local recourse. Therefore, EasyMarkets provides stronger regulatory safeguards, but OctaFX compensates with lower costs. Thai traders should prioritize license verification and understand that FCA regulation is considered Tier-1.

Muslim Thai traders can open swap-free (Islamic) accounts at both brokers. EasyMarkets offers them on request, with no swap charges on overnight positions, but no profit on swaps either. OctaFX provides swap-free conditions automatically on all standard accounts, but may apply a fee after 7 days for certain instruments. For hold periods under a week, OctaFX is simpler; for longer-term trading, EasyMarkets’ policy is more favorable. Thai traders should confirm the specific terms with each broker to avoid unexpected charges.
